NanoProof® 3-001X
Aculon® NanoProof® 3-001X is a specially designed nano-coating formulation with 0.1% solids for electronics and printed circuit board (PCB) applications to improve anti-wetting and surface resistance to chemicals, corrosion, and moisture.
Aculon® NanoProof® 3-001X is an advanced nano-coating solution formulated as part of Aculon's electronic coating series to provide enhanced moisture and environmental protection of electronic components. As an ultrathin coating with excellent hydrophobicity and oleophobicity, NanoProof® 3-001X effectively stops the bleed out and spread of epoxies, resins, and underfill materials, as well as prevents the penetration and damage of components from chemicals and moisture.
Aculon® NanoProof® 3-001X can be easily applied using spray, flow coat, brush, or dip applications and dries quickly, within five minutes, without the need for curing.
Specifications
Product type: Fluorinated coating, electronic Solids: 0.1% Fluoroacrylate Solvent: Fluorosolvent Color: Light green Density: 1.5 g/mL Viscosity: <20 cP Boiling point temperature of solvent: 56.2°C (133°F) Specific gravity: 1.49 g/mL Shelf life: 2 years
Features & Benefits
Replaces 3M Novec 1720 Noncuring conformal coating Anti-stiction Anti-wetting Easy to apply Quick drying One-step process Resistant to corrosion, chemicals, and moisture Hydrophobic and oleophobic Compatible with metals, polymers, and semiconductors Pushes through conductivity within two hours Thermally and electrically stable Can be applied by spray equipment, brush, or flow coat Five-minute cure time
Problems Solved
Damage or corrosion to coating surfaces from chemicals, moisture, etc. Nonreworkable coating solutions if the application contains imperfections
Applications
Aculon® NanoProof® 3-001X is a specialty, high-quality coating for the electronics industry and can be applied in a variety of methods, including but not limited to the following:
Dip coating Spraying Brushing, hand applied Automatic dispenser or flow coat
